Classificações
3.ª Etapa: Portimão – Alto do Malhão, 193km
1.º Sergio Henao (Sky), 4h53m15s
2.º Rui Costa (Movistar), a 3s
3.º Lieuwe Westra (Vacansoleil-DCM), 5s
4.º Rigoberto Urán (Sky), a 7s
5.º Tiago Machado (RadioShack-Leopard), mt
6.º Andreas Klöden (RadioShack-Leopard), mt
7.º Joshua Edmonson (Sky), mt
8.º Denis Menchov (Katusha), mt
9.º Jesús Herrada (Caja Rural), a 12s
10.º Michal Kwiatkowski (Omega Pharma-Quick Step), mt
11.º Tony Martin (Omega Pharma-Quick Step), a 18s
12.º Miguel Minguez (Euskaltel-Euskadi), a 24s
13.º André Cardoso (Caja Rural), a 33s
14.º Wouter Poels (Vacansoleil-DCM)), mt
15.º Jonathan Castroviejo (Movistar), mt

Geral Individual
1.º Sergio Henao (Sky), 14h50m49s
2.º Rui Costa (Movistar), a 7s
3.º Tiago Machado (RadioShack-Leopard), a 11s
4.º Lieuwe Westra (Vacansoleil-DCM), mt
5.º Andreas Klöden (RadioShack-Leopard), a 17s
6.º Rigoberto Urán (Sky), mt
7.º Denis Menchov (Katusha), mt
8.º Joshua Edmonson (Sky), mt
9.º Michal Kwiatkowski (Omega Pharma-Quick Step), a 19s
10.º Jesús Herrada (Movistar), a 22s
11.º Tony Martin (Omega Pharma-Quick Step), a 28s
12.º Miguel Miguez (Euskaltel-Euskadi), a 34s
13.º André Cardoso (Caja Rural), a 43s
14.º Jonathan Castroviejo (Movistar), mt
15.º Jan Bakelants (RadioShack-Leopard), mt
